cold start solenoid and thermo-time switch



While trouble shooting my 3.0 transplant into the GTV-6,
I discovered that the cold start solenoid was not working.
I replaced it and still no luck. I then assumed that the thermo-time switch
was the culprit. I tested it's resistance against the block with a OHM
meter and
it was not grounding properly.  When tested against itself it was fine,
when tested against
it's housing, again ok. When tested against any other ground, other than
its own housing,
it was not reading properly. The problem was that its housing was not
grounding to the rest of the car!
All the Permatex I used in the assembly process was insulating it and its
housing from the
rest of the car. Instead of disassembling the whole mess, I chose to simply
run a ground wire
from it's housing to the body and it now works fine.
